| | |  | Identity & Access Management | Home » » Understanding and Preventing Violence: Biobehavioral Influences, Volume 2 | | | | | | | Product Promotions: | | | | | Description: | | This volume contains commissioned reviews of research on biological influences on violent or aggressive behaviour. The areas reviewed include genetic contributions to the probability of violent and related behaviours; brain structure and functioning as implicated in aggressive behaviour; the roles of hormonal and neurological interactions in violent behaviour; the neurochemistry of violence and aggression and its implications for the management of those behaviours; and dietary influences on violent behaviour. | | | Product Details: | | | Author:
